Greetings Traffic Junction, I've discovered some information that may constitute an answer. I spoke with a lady named Julie at Amazon Seller Support (877.251.0696) and she told me that Amazon Japan doesn't have a Marketplace so there's not a way to sell/auction the gift certificate there. I also called customer service at Amazon (800.201.7575)and a gentleman there said that each country site is independent and no currency exchange is possible from one site to another (which you probably already knew). However, (as Julie instructed) if you visit http://amazon.jp and scroll all the way to the bottom, you'll see a link in English that reads "IN ENGLISH" and goes to the URL http://www.amazon.co.jp/exec/obidos/tg/browse/-/1094656/ref=gw_sn_eng/249-6371183-4591527 On that page, you'll see that you can search *and* shop in English. So, there is a way for you to easily redeem the gift certificate. The items will ship from Japan but at least I have found a way for you to redeem the certificate if you choose.
